#eddf8f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#eddf8f is composed of 92.9% red, 87.5%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 5.9% magenta, 39.7%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 51.1 degrees, a saturation of 72.3% and a lightness of 74.5%. #eddf8f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#dbbf1f.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c99.

#eddf8f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#eddf8f has RGB values of R:237, G:223, B:143 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.06, Y:0.4,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15589263.

Shades and Tints of #eddf8f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060601 is the darkest color, while #fdfcf4 is the lightest one.
